A typical ITC experiment (for experimental setup and instrumentation see Pierce et al., 1999) consists of sequential injections of a ligand with extremely accurately adjusted volume into the receptor solution. Both the ligand and the receptor have to be solved in exactly the same buffer. It is crucial that the heat of dilution is subtracted by titration of the same ligand into buffer only. [Pg.165]
